ENTERTAINMENT.

TOWN HALL.

Manhandling villains and heroes icforo the camera is no particular ask fo;r Paul Lukas, the noted

Bulgarian actor, who Avent to Holyrood to appear in Paramount pic-

tures. Lukas is a strong sabre fencer, and his arms are as sturdy as

(hose of a steel woilker. The handsome European actor engages in

two skirmishes in Paramount’s stage story, “Manhattan Cocktail,” Avhich co-features Nancy Carroll and Richard Alien. One of his hand-to-hand engagements is with Arlen, himself a first-class boxer, and the other AAntli Danny O’Shea,

who has tackled half of the ring’s professional champions in gymna-

sium, Avorkouts. “Manhattan Cockail” is a backstage story of 3roadway from the pen of Ernest lajda. It is being featured at the [’own Hall on Wednesday. Also

final episode of “Tarzan the Mighty,” a comedy and Ncavs. Usual prices. Estelle Brody, avlio Avill be re-

membered as the charming little “Mademoiselle from Armentieres,” leturns to the screen as the fascinating “Mademoiselle Parley-Voo,” and she certainly is very chic. John Stuart, is her handsome husband, and John Longden is the dashing leading man of the sheik type in the revue. This picture will tread the programme at Friday’s Cabaret.
